
Hello and welcome to the Diversity Educators Network (DEN). The DEN is a new initiative established by the Affirmative Action Office at Penn State University. The DEN will serve as a network for diversity advocates and educators in the Penn State community to share best practices and resources and to provide support for one another. This network will also act as a resource for the greater community to be able to call upon experts in a specific functional area to provide workshops and trainings.
The DEN has members who are experienced diversity and inclusion practitioners and educator, as well as individuals seeking training and an opportunity to enhance their skills in order to become diversity educators.
Time commitment
The time commitment is minimal overall. Our office will provide an annual meeting that all DEN members are expected to attend. We will also offer training throughout the year for those interested in becoming a diversity educator or enhancing their skills. The Train the Trainer program will be announced at a later date. You may receive a request to provide a training or workshop. Accepting the opportunity will depend upon your availability.
